Transaction 2e39a7186be8ea36ab822b6417084f46a1177800d6e5e64da258062be78e1b39
1 Input
2 Outputs
- 2e39a7186be8ea36ab822b6417084f46a1177800d6e5e64da258062be78e1b39:0
- 2e39a7186be8ea36ab822b6417084f46a1177800d6e5e64da258062be78e1b39:1
value 1400058
address 3MmbTMtbVzTWFh4rTLB1eamdvhnW98g6Ri
value 5549877
address 124msLr6yU819TWx1AAnW5oXDWKQMZsCvY